Ok time for a short thread on who is actually on strike (hint #NotJustLecturers) Throughout the strike many people (special mention @FionaEWhelan) have been calling out media coverage, @UCU, supporters, & even strikers themselves for calling #USSstrike a ‘lecturers strike’ 1/n This is not just a matter of words - its important. Firstly, as someone on strike who isn't a lecturer, it makes me feel marginalised (when I already feel vulnerable being on strike) it excludes us from the solidarity that is so important in #USSstrike 2/n
